Meso-alkylidenyl-thia(p-benzi)porphyrin and its ring expanded analog containingexocyclic C-C double bonds at meso-positions, undergo initial protonation at the exocyclic alkylidene alpha-carbon.

A coating including a carbon nanotube layer including carbon nanotubes; and a coating layer on the carbon nanotube layer is disclosed. The coating layer may include a polyurethane polymer, a polyacrylate polymer, a polysiloxane polymer, an epoxy polymer, or a combination thereof. A coated substrate including the coating is also disclosed.

A method in accordance with the present invention has: providing an ethylene-vinyl acetate copolymer; mixing the ethylene-vinyl acetate copolymer, a photoinitiator, a coupling agent, a crosslink-assisting agent, an ultraviolet light absorber, and a radical scavenger to obtain a mixture; and forming the mixture into a film at a specific temperature to obtain the laminated glass interlayer film. The laminated glass in accordance with the present invention is has high transmittance and low haze, and also shortens the production time, thereby enhancing the quality and applicability.
